I know this wont make much difference, but numbering parallels is very, very expensive to do.

The issue is that there isn't a lot of people who can do this sort of stuff. If you look at Panini, they have invested in the infrastructure to have a couple of machines that solely do serial numbering (they have the work to keep it fully utilised). In Australia, there isn't a huge need and you would struggle to find someone who could do this for you at a reasonable cost.

It's a bit like collating and packaging cards.....only 1 maybe 2 people who can do it locally here in Australia. There just isn't the scale of work to have people specialising in this type of work.

If you do it, it has to be in big enough quantity to bring down the cost, but for a handful of cards, way too expensive.

Info from select re:app

We have received a number of inquiries regarding the status of the AFL Select App.

We have decided not to release an App in 2016. While we were excited to bring our cards to life via the App, our number one priority is our physical card products and this is our short-term focus. We wish to ensure continued innovation and to maintain the highly collectable nature of our products. Several key changes have already been introduced for Series 1, with more to follow in Series 2 and in the years to come.

Overall the response to the App was extremely positive, with both the 2014 and 2015 versions achieving a 4½-star rating in the App Store. We are also extremely proud that the App achieved Bronze at the 2014 IAB MIXX awards in the Branded Mobile Application category.

We’ll continue to review how best we can integrate our cards into the digital space, whether that be via an App or simply a greater social media presence.

The 2014 and 2015 App will remain in operation however the fantasy element featured in the 2015 App will not operate in 2016.
